That is according to the Operational Command "South" of the Armed Forces of Ukraine.
"A significant part of the missiles was destroyed by the air defense forces. The rest caused destruction to the port infrastructure, at least six residential buildings, including apartment blocks. Dozens of cars, facades and roofs in many buildings in the city were damaged, windows were broken. On one of the central squares of Odesa, the cathedral of the Ukrainian Orthodox Church (moscow Patriarchate) was damaged by a russian missile. Two architectural monuments were harmed," the Command said on its official page on Facebook.

There are several shell craters in the city, outages of power lines, which may make traffic difficult.
In its turne, the Air Force Command of the Armed Forces of Ukraine clarifies, that russian forces fired 19 missiles of various typeson Odesa Oblast while Ukrainian air defence forces have shot down nine missiles.
In particular, according to a statement of Ukraine’s Air Force Command on its official page on Facebook russian troops used a total of 19 missiles of various types:
- 5 Oniks cruise missiles from the Bastion coastal missile system (Crimea);
- 3 Kh-22 air-launched cruise missiles, launched from Tu-22M3 aircraft (Black Sea);
- 4 Kalibr sea-launched cruise missiles, likely from a submarine (Black Sea);
- 5 Iskander-K land-launched cruise missiles (Crimea);
- 2 Iskander-M ballistic missiles (Crimea).

Ukrainian air defence forces destroyed nine air targets: 4 Kalibr and 5 Iskander-K missiles, the Air Force Command of the Armed Forces of Ukraine reports.
According to the National Police of Ukraine, one person was killed and 22 people, including four children, were injured.
"On the night of July 22-23, russian troops launched yet another massive attack on the territory of Odesa city and the region. As of 04:00, it was established that one person was killed and 22 people, including four children, were injured as a result of the enemy shelling of the city of Odesa," the National Police of Ukraine said on its official page on Facebook.
According to the police, civilian infrastructure objects, apartment blocks and private residential buildings, cars were damaged and destroyed as a result of the missile attack. Many houses have damaged facades and roofs, broken windows.
President of Ukraine,Volodymyr Zelensky, says on the case that Ukraine will definitely deliver a response to russian terrorists for their strikes on Odesa.
"Missiles against peaceful cities, against residential buildings, a cathedral... There can be no excuse for russian evil. As always, this evil will lose. And there will definitely be a retaliation to russian terrorists for Odesa. They will feel this retaliation,” Zelensky wrote on his official page on Facebook. in a caption to photos showing the consequences of the latest massive strike on the city.
He expressed his gratitude to all those who provide assistance to Odesa residents, and to all those whose thoughts and prayers are with Odesa.
"We will get through this. We will restore peace. And for this, we must defeat the russian evil," the President emphasized.
